Multi-Spectral Imaging And Sensing
2/23/2016
Marco Snikkers wrapped up our Photonics West 2016 coverage by introducing us to a pixel sensor that acts as an 8-channel spectrometer for biomedical, fluorescence marking, and colorimeter applications, as well as a multi-spectral camera that can monitor specific wavelengths in real-time.

Fastest Infrared Camera Now Even Faster
4/23/2015
Vincent Farley of Telops closed out Day 2 of SPIE’s DSS 2015 with an introduction to the FAST-IR 2K - with 2,000 FPS, it furthers their foothold as the manufacturer of the fastest infrared camera on the market today. Farley also caught us up on some of the new and notable features of Telops' Hyper-Cam hyperspectral imaging camera.
